Welcome toThe Parke at Foulkstone
The Parke at Foulkstone is an exclusive, boutique 55+ active adult community located in the heart of North Wilmington. This private enclave of just 31 luxury carriage-style townhomes offers a maintenance-free oasis surrounded by forest conservation and tree-lined walking paths, all while being minutes from the premier shopping and dining of Concord Pike.

About the Homes 🗝️
The homes at The Parke at Foulkstone are expertly crafted by Montchanin Builders, featuring the popular Kingsley floorplan. These two-story carriage homes offer approximately 1,935 square feet of living space designed for long-term comfort. Key features include:
First-Floor Living: A primary suite on the main level with a spa-like bath and a massive walk-in closet.
Open-Concept Design: A gourmet kitchen with a central island that flows seamlessly into a double-height great room with soaring ceilings and oversized windows.
Flexibility for Guests: The second floor features a spacious loft (perfect for a home office), a second full bedroom, and a full bath, plus a large unfinished storage room.
Luxury Finishes: Modern exteriors with stone accents, 2-car garages, and private rear patios (with options for screened-in porches).

HOA and Maintenance 🛠️
The HOA at The Parke at Foulkstone is comprehensive, ensuring residents can truly enjoy their retirement without picking up a shovel or a rake.
Total Exterior Care: Includes lawn maintenance (front, rear, and side) and professional landscaping.
Winter Services: Snow removal for community roads and common walkways.
Property Protection: Common area insurance and reserve funds for long-term community care.
Utilities: Residential trash and recycling collection.
Monthly Fee: Approximately $259 (As of February 2026).

Tax Benefits 💰
Choosing North Wilmington allows you to keep more of your retirement savings through the "Delaware Advantage":
NO Sales Tax: Save on everything from groceries to high-end furniture.
Low Property Taxes: Delaware remains one of the most tax-friendly states for homeowners in the U.S.
Social Security Friendly: Delaware does not tax your Social Security benefits.
Retirement Income Exclusion: Retirees aged 60+ can exclude up to $12,500 of pension or 401(k) income from state taxes.
